Profiles
The "Profiles" procedure provides for each commune a descriptive file, according to the chosen indicators.
Example:
The "Profiles" procedure which processes indicators concerning population divided by groups of age, shows the following information:
· the average of the values of each indicator involved into the analysis (e.g.: the indicator %POP_0_6_ANI - meaning the percentage of population between 0 and 6 years has a mean value of 5,25% of total population, for all analyzed cases.
· descriptive files for each analyzed case (wards). Every file comprises indicators added to the analysis reported to the average: in case the mean of the indicator for this case is above average, the yellow bar is at the right of the mean value, while if positioned below the mean value, the yellow bar is at its left. Its real values are indicated near each indicator, for the selected case, in order to be compared to the mean value displayed for all of the analyzed cases.
Case Study:
For commune Alexandru cel Bun ward the situation looks as follows:

· the percentage of population of age between 0 and 6 years is slightly over the average; the percentage of population between 0 and 6 years is 5,63% from the total population compared to 5,25% which is the average for all the analyzed cases;
· the percentage of population between 15 and 19 years is less than the average for all the cases analyzed: the ward Alexandru cel Bun has 8.3% population of age between 7 and 14 years compared to 9,79% population of age between 7 and 14 years for all the analyzed cases.
The files of several communes can be compared in order to observe the differences between them.
